Understanding the Foundations of Nigeria’s Security Issues and Their socioeconomic Consequences
The deterioration of Nigeria’s security habitat can be attributed to a multitude of interconnected factors stemming from historical grievances as well as political and socio-economic conditions.The emergence of militant groups alongside a failing judicial system has heightened national insecurity. Geographical inequalities, especially evident in the Northeast region, have become hotbeds for violence leading to an urgent humanitarian crisis. As communities face fear-induced displacement, the link between insecurity and underdevelopment becomes increasingly apparent—a vicious cycle that hampers efforts toward stability.
The socioeconomic effects of this growing crisis are extensive; they permeate nearly every facet of Nigerian life. Economic instability is reflected in soaring unemployment rates as businesses close their doors due to extortion or violence threats. Agriculture—the backbone of Nigeria’s economy—is severely impacted as farmers hesitate to work their lands out of safety concerns. Key repercussions include:
- Rising Poverty Rates: Insecurity has thrust millions into extreme poverty.
- Diminished Foreign Investment: International corporations are reluctant to invest amid ongoing instability.
- Talent Exodus: Skilled professionals are leaving for safer countries wich stifles potential growth.
tackling the roots of this security predicament requires more than just military intervention; it necessitates an all-encompassing strategy focused on economic recovery and social unity for fostering a stable future.
Expert Recommendations for Effective Strategies to Address Insecurity
Experts assert that resolving Nigeria’s security challenges demands a thorough approach involving multiple strategies. Effective measures include enhancing community policing efforts while encouraging collaboration between local law enforcement agencies and federal authorities along with promoting inter-agency cooperation.Furthermore,investing in technological innovations such as advanced surveillance systems can substantially reduce criminal activities by enabling proactive rather than reactive responses. Notable strategies proposed by experts encompass:
- Community Empowerment: Involving local residents in safety initiatives fosters ownership and vigilance.
- Sophisticated Intelligence Sharing: Improving dialog among security organizations ensures prompt action against threats.
